>  It may be associated to the coincidence of loads. Max kW should be the
> installed power (the same in both cases), while peak demand is associated to
> the simultaneous maxumum load. Your baseline and design cases, even if they
> have the same annual energy consumption, may have a different coincident
> peak because one of the lads (for example AC) is displaced to a different
> peak hour.

> Hi all,
>
> Does anyone know the difference between the Max KW and Peak enduse numbers
> generated by the PS-E report.
> We simulated the Baseline and Design case models with same equipment power
> densities and operating schedules and are still seeing a difference in the
> Peak end use energy of the building even though the annual KWH and the Max
> KW (from the PS-E report) is the same.
> Does anybody have an idea why this is happening?I have attached screenshots
> of the 2 sim file reports.
